EQUINUNK, PA — Manchester Library will hold two blow-out book sales: the first on Saturday, November 18 from 9 a.m. to 12 noon and the second on Saturday, December 2, also 9 a.m. to 12 noon.
The library is buried in books of all description—popular fiction, history, human interest, biographies, action thrillers, romance, cooking and craft books, some children’s books and more—including new or like-new suitable for holiday gift giving. Paperbacks are sold for a nickel apiece and hard covers for $0.50 each, no matter the size. All sales benefit the library and help keep its doors open in the coming year.
Come for a cup of coffee and a cookie or two. You can fill a box or bag (or both) with your winter reading material and set your own price; make a donation to the library.
The library closes from early December to the first week of April. It is located off Route 191, about two miles south of Equinunk’s village center. Call 570/224-8500 for information.
